THCA, or tetrahydrocannabinolic acid, is a component with the cannabis plant that turns into THC when it gets warm.

Visualize cannabinoid receptors as locks that need a important to open. THCA is not the right condition, so it would not open the doorway. But decarboxylation modifications The form from the THCA molecule, transforming it right into a vital that may unlock psychoactive effects.

In short, if you're looking for getting high, you're superior off consuming cannabis items that have already been decarboxylated.

A 2011 in vitro examine located that THCA can inhibit prostaglandin output. Prostaglandins are chemical compounds in the human body that cause inflammatory reactions. On top of that, a 2021 study performed on mice with liver damage discovered that THCA substantially lowered inflammation inside their livers.

THCA occurs in high quantities in cannabis plants and may be extracted and isolated as THCA powder, “diamonds” or crystals. This THCA isolate can then be integrated into other solutions, like pre-rolls or simply hemp buds.
